90 From Life: Day 26 – Three Oil Cans

This is day 26 of my 90 day challenge to do one new painting from life each day.
You may notice that the background, which is visible at the border, has a much lighter color than on others from this series. This is the tone, which is just a thin layer of paint which cuts down on the glare of the pure white ground.
I almost always use a middle gray for this, but I’m experimenting with some different toning. I liked working with this tone today, and will do a few more. Based on this, I may end up rethinking how I tone my panels and canvases.
